=================================================================== RCS file: /home/cvs/OpenXM_contrib2/asir2000/Attic/Imakefile,v retrieving revision 1.19 retrieving revision 1.21 diff -u -p -r1.19 -r1.21 --- OpenXM_contrib2/asir2000/Attic/Imakefile 2001/12/28 01:28:54 1.19 +++ OpenXM_contrib2/asir2000/Attic/Imakefile 2002/07/26 00:33:01 1.21 @@ -2,7 +2,7 @@ * Copyright (c) 1994-2000 FUJITSU LABORATORIES LIMITED * All rights reserved. * - * $OpenXM: OpenXM_contrib2/asir2000/Imakefile,v 1.18 2001/12/25 08:59:47 noro Exp $ + * $OpenXM: OpenXM_contrib2/asir2000/Imakefile,v 1.20 2002/07/25 04:47:40 noro Exp $ */ #define RISA_TOP_DIR #include "include/Risa.tmpl" @@ -41,7 +41,7 @@ DEPLIBS = #endif PLIB = parse/libparse.a -GLIB = gc5.3/libasir-gc.a +GLIB = gc/libasir-gc.a ELIB = engine/libca.a FLIB=fft/libdft.a ALIB = asm/libasm.a @@ -63,7 +63,7 @@ PROGRAMS = asir TOBJ = parse/main.o $(FOBJ) UOBJ = parse/umain.o $(FOBJ) -SUBDIRS = engine fft asm gc5.3 parse builtin io plot lib include +SUBDIRS = engine fft asm parse builtin io plot lib include LIBS0 = $(BLIB) $(PLIB) $(IOLIB) $(PLLIB) $(ELIB) $(FLIB) $(ALIB) LIBS = $(LIBS0) $(GLIB) @@ -100,6 +100,13 @@ $(LIBASIR): $(LIBS0) ( cd libtmp; $(AR) ../$@ *.o ) $(RANLIB) $@ +$(GLIB): parse/gc_risa.o + ( cd gc; make) + -rm gc/libasir-gc.a + cp gc/.libs/libgc.a $(GLIB) + ar q $(GLIB) parse/gc_risa.o + $(RANLIB) $(GLIB) + install:: $(PROGRAMS) MakeDir($(ASIR_LIBDIR)) $(INSTALL) $(INSTALLFLAGS) $(PROGRAMS) $(ASIR_LIBDIR) @@ -162,3 +169,5 @@ install-include:: clean:: $(RM) -r libtmp $(LIBRARIES) + -$(RM) -f gc/libasir-gc.a + (cd gc; make 'clean')